This week I had some fun cleaning up all the prototype code. I added comments, refactored code and generally simplified some stuff. I also implemented some basic managers which should make our lives a whole lot easier.
For example: I added a player manager which sets all the properties for the player, instead of having to edit values in every individual script. With tooltips added to every value, teammates should have an easier time tweaking values, as they can also check what exactly they are changing.
This is what it looks like in the editor:
I also added a health bar and a shield indicator. This should give the player more feedback. The plan is so use those same indicators for other pickups at a later time.
The health bar can be seen in the bottom right of the screen, and the shield indicator is placed in the top right, and only appears when the player has shield.